I have been on the lookout for a decent iPOD A/V solution for the last couple of years and although I fitted the Apple A/V lead some time ago and can listen to music and watch video I have no remote or device control apart from the iPOD itself which is a pain.
![]() One thing I like about this solution though is when an incoming telephone call comes in the audio is muted as the RNS-E is switched to telephone mode but the video keeps on running of course. And it's cheap as chips! ![]() Apple Composite AV Cable - Apple Store (U.K.) I know Kufatec have their IMA Multimedia Adapter with device control but I would then lose my TV - although I guess analogue will be phased out soon anyway so that is still an option. KUFATEC GmbH - IMA Multimedia Adapter mit Steuerung "Basic-Plus" 35538 I remember looking at the DLO HomeDock Deluxe a long time ago and even emailed them to suggest they look at a dedicated In-Car solution...ISTR somebody fitting the HomeDock Deluxe but it did not tick all the boxes for me at the time and the remote was IR where I would have preferred RF. DLO | HomeDock Deluxe They later released the DLO Music Remote which again nearly had it all - apart from the Holy Grail of device control from the head unit. Again it nearly ticked all the boxes apart from one very important feature - it lacked video output - I could almost have lived without device control if it had video output. DLO | HomeDock Music Remote Now I see they have the DLO HomeDock HD that seems like it might work in the confines of the car and has an RF remote. DLO | HomeDock HD But...has anyone seen this; VEHICLEDOCK FOR IPOD | NAV TV - Leader in OEM Video Integration It mentions device control from the head unit but not sure if it can be controlled from the RNS-E or whether you have to use the supplied remote - not sure if RF or IR?
